An-Najah U-Sketch team from the Computer Engineering Department won first place, above all Palestinian Universities in the 7th Annual IT EXPO 2014 organized at Birzeit University last week.

Over 30 teams from the different Palestinian Universities competed, with projects judged by a panel of specialists from different Palestinian Universities and companies.

The winning project U-Sketch, supervised by Dr. Samer Arandi, was a computer application that turns regular items and surfaces, such as the whiteboard eraser or a pencil, into an interactive surface. The computer technology can be efficiently used in private and public schools for a creative and attractive way of teaching.

Dr. Amer Hammouz, Dean of Engineering and Information Technology, congratulated the winning team saying that the excellence of the students of Engineering and IT in general and Computer Engineering in particular is the fruit of the teaching staff’s efforts for which they deserve thanks and appreciation. Dr. Hammouz added that this win is a new addition to the University’s many awards and proof of the entrepreneurship of its students.

The U-Sketch team aspires to make their application available on the local market to help refine education by integrating technology.

 

Notes:

1-      The participating universities were An-Najah, Birzeit, the Arab American University in Jenin, Al-Quds University, and Polytechnic University.

2-      The U-Sketch team consisted of 4 Computer Engineering students: Rawan Abu Zahra, Zeinab Emran, Mai Abu Shamma, and Yazan Emran.

3-      This is U-Sketch’s 2nd achievement as it has recently made high level achievements in the Microsoft Imagine Cup Competition.
